Of China's six ancient capitals, Xi'an is the most renowned. The present city is located in the heart of the Shaanxi Province, in north-west China. This strategic area formed the eastern terminus of the great Silk Road and has been the site for the capital city of 10 imperial dynasties.
Xi'an, once known as Chiang-an, is the most distinguished of the "six ancient capitals" of China. Situated on the central plain of China, at a key geographical site where the Silk Road began, it was the main city of ten imperial dynasties including the Qin, Han and Tang and today is a veritable museum of relics from prehistorical and imperial times. As such, it remains a major centre for visitors, both Chinese and foreign. This book outlines the main changes in the city's appearance over the years, its political and military achievements, its culture and arts, its transport systems and the lifestyle of its peoples.
